About The Role We’re hiring a Senior HR Business Partner (HRBP) to serve as a strategic advisor to business leaders and partner firms—aligning people strategy to business goals and helping leaders build healthy, high-performing teams. You’ll partner closely with leaders and our Human Capital Centers of Excellence (Recruiting, L&D, Total Rewards, Benefits, Payroll, HR Ops/Compliance) to implement scalable people programs and drive consistent adoption across the organization. Responsibilities Partner with business leaders to translate firm strategy into clear people priorities (workforce planning, org design, leadership effectiveness)Lead quarterly people metrics reviews (hiring, attrition, engagement, org health) and drive action plansCoach leaders on performance management, employee relations, and risk-aware decision-makingFacilitate succession and talent reviews; support career pathing and Individual Development Plans (as tools are rolled out)Support change management and post-integration stabilization during periods of growth and transformationEnsure consistent, compliant application of people practices; partner with HR Ops/Compliance to close gaps Qualifications 10+ years of progressive HR experience, including 3+ years of experience as an HRBPDemonstrated experience partnering with senior leaders in high-growth, multi-location environmentsStrength in organizational design, performance/ER coaching, talent planning, and change managementComfort using data to diagnose issues, prioritize work, and track outcomesAbility to influence without authority and build trust quickly with varied stakeholdersStrong written and verbal communication; pragmatic, execution-oriented approach Compensation & Benefits The total rewards package at Current includes base salary and benefits.
